THE SCIENCE BEHIND THE PRODUCT theralase is the only laser on the market known to activate all three cellular pathways 660 nm - Adenosine Triphosphate (ATP) Pathway: Healing Theralase stimulates the mitochondria of the cell to produce more Adenosine Triphosphate (ATP or basic cell energy) to accelerate tissue repair. (Proceedings of the National Academy of Science 2003) Cells that lack energy are unable to participate in the healing process. Laser energy is delivered to injured cells, which are able to absorb the light and convert it into chemical energy, which is then used to accelerate tissue repair. Once cells are fully energized they are able to stimulate each other to rebuild and heal the injured area. 905 nm - Nitric Oxide (NO) Pathway: Inflammation Independent research proves that the proprietary Theralase 905nm superpulsed laser technology increases the production of NO by over 700%, increasing vasodilation and decreasing inflammation versus other competitive wavelengths. (Lasers in Surgery and Medicine, 2009). When tissue injury occurs, the inflammatory process is initiated to immobilize the area and prevent further damage to our body. This process is usually associated with pain caused by inflammation exerting pressure on nerve endings. In order to decrease inflammation in the particular region, the body produces Nitric Oxide (NO). Nitric Oxide has been proven to relax the vascular network, dilate the capillaries, improve vascular function, protect against cell injury and help rebalance the immune response. This process not only reduces inflammation but brings much needed oxygen and other metabolites to the injured tissue aiding in their natural healing. Cristae Matrix Inner Membrane Outer Membrane 905 nm - Lipid Absorption Pathway: Pain Theralase laser technology effectively removes the pain signal at source by rebalancing the sodium potassium pathway. (Harvard Medical School 2010) Neurons use electrical and chemical signals to transmit information. The transmission of pain is primarily due to an expulsion of sodium ions (Na+) and an influx of potassium (K+) ions into the nerve cell across the cellular membrane, altering the electrical potential difference of the nerve cell. The peak absorption of lipids occurs in the near infrared wavelength range of 905 nm to 910 nm. Since the cellular membrane is a bilipid membrane, laser light in the 905 nm range increases the porosity of the cellular membrane. This increased cellular membrane porosity allows the reabsorption of sodium ions and the expulsion of potassium ions across the membrane rebalancing the sodium-potassium pump and removing the pain signal at source. CLINICAL PROOF over 3,000 clinical studies worldwide have proven the effectiveness of laser therapy EFFICACY OF LOW-LEVEL LASER THERAPY IN THE MANAGEMENT OF NECK PAIN: a SYSTEMatIC REVIEW AND META-ANALYSIS OF RANDOMIZED PLACEBO OR ACTIVE TREATMENT CONTROLLED TRIALS Roberta Chow et al. The Lancet, November 2009 Sixteen randomized controlled clinical trials were identified for analysis totalling 820 patients. In acute neck pain, results of two trials showed a relative risk (RR) of 1.69 for pain improvement for LLLT versus placebo. Five trials of chronic neck pain showed a RR for pain improvement of 4.05 using LLLT. Eleven trials reported reductions in pain intensity when measured using the Visual Analog Scale. Seven trials provided follow up data for 1 to 22 weeks and saw short term pain relief persisting in the medium term using LLLT. Side effects from LLLT were mild and not different from those of placebo. Study Conclusion: LLLT reduces pain immediately after treatment in acute neck pain and for up to 22 weeks after completion of treatment in patients with chronic neck pain. Effects of 904 NM low-level laser therapy in the management of lateral epicondylitis: a randomized Controlled trial Lam and Chein. Photomedicine and Laser Surgery, April 2007 The study evaluated the effectiveness of 904 nm Low Level Laser Therapy (LLLT) in the management of lateral epicondylitis. Thirty-nine patients with lateral epicondylitis were examined and treated with pain levels determined by the Visual Analog Scale. The study revealed that LLLT in addition to exercise is effective in improving the grip strength and subjective rating of physical function of patients with lateral epicondylitis. Study Conclusion : LLLT is highly effective in treating lateral epicondylitis efficacy of 904 NM gallium arsenide low level laser therapy in the management of chronic myofascial pain in the neck: a double blind and randomized controlled trial Ali Gur, MD et al. Lasers in Surgery and Medicine, 2004 A prospective, double blind, randomized and controlled trial was conducted in patients with chronic myofascial pain syndrome (MPS) in the neck to evaluate the effects of infrared low level 904 nm Gallium Arsenide (GaAs) laser therapy (LLLT) on clinical and quality of life. Results showed that the laser group experienced a significant improvement in pain at all outcome measures (p<0.01) over the placebo group. Study Conclusion: LLLT is highly effective in treating Chronic Myofascial Pain Syndrome Pg.9
